Certified Specialist Programme: Nutritional Strategies for Mental Health - UK Job Market Insights
| Career Role (Nutritional Therapist, Mental Health) | Description |
|---|---|
| Registered Nutritional Therapist specializing in Mental Wellbeing | Develop and implement personalized nutritional plans for clients experiencing mental health challenges. Strong understanding of the gut-brain axis and its impact on mental wellness is crucial. |
| Mental Health Dietitian (Nutritional Therapy) | Integrate nutritional therapy into mental health treatment plans, working collaboratively with psychiatrists and other healthcare professionals. Focus on improving dietary habits to support mental health recovery. |
| Clinical Nutritionist (Mental Health Focus) | Conduct nutritional assessments, provide dietary counseling, and monitor progress for individuals with diagnosed mental health conditions. Deep knowledge of nutrient deficiencies and their impact on mental wellbeing is key. |
